In which algorithm first the maximum element is found and then placed at the end?
Heapsort algorithm
The Heapsort algorithm involves preparing the list by first turning it into a max heap. The algorithm then repeatedly swaps the first value of the list with the last value, decreasing the range of values considered in the heap operation by one, and sifting the new first value into its position in the heap.

<h3>What is an array?</h3>
  • A collection of items that are either values or variables is referred to as an array in computer science.
  • Each element is identifiable by at least one array index or key.
  • Each element of an array is recorded such that a mathematical formula can be used to determine its position from its index tuple.
  • A linear array, often known as a one-dimensional array, is the simplest sort of data structure.
